The Enduring Appeal of Kawaii and Dessert

Let’s begin by exploring the core elements that make this art form so captivating. Kawaii, often translated as “cute” or “adorable,” is deeply rooted in Japanese culture. Its origins can be traced back to the 1970s, with the emergence of rounded handwriting styles and the popularity of characters with childlike features. Over time, it has evolved from a trend into a pervasive aesthetic, influencing everything from fashion and product design to communication and entertainment. Key characteristics of kawaii include large, expressive eyes; bright, often pastel colors; simplified shapes; and rounded, soft features. These elements collectively evoke feelings of innocence, playfulness, and comfort. Psychologists suggest that the appeal of kawaii stems from its ability to trigger a sense of nostalgia and security, reminding us of childhood joys and providing a welcome escape from the complexities of adult life.

Techniques and Styles in Kawaii Dessert Food Drawings

Creating kawaii dessert food drawings involves a unique blend of artistic skill and creative imagination. While the style is often perceived as simple, mastering the techniques requires practice and attention to detail. The foundation of any kawaii drawing lies in basic shapes and lines. Artists often begin by sketching simple circles, squares, and triangles, gradually refining them into the desired dessert form. Exaggerated features are crucial. Think of oversized, sparkling eyes that convey a sense of wonder, and tiny, endearing mouths that add to the overall cuteness. Color plays a vital role, and is often the key to adding cuteness and a playful nature to the dessert kawaii cute food drawings. Bright and pastel palettes are commonly used to evoke a sense of sweetness and joy.

The subjects of these drawings are as diverse as the desserts themselves. Cakes, cupcakes, and pastries are popular choices, often adorned with sprinkles, frosting, and adorable faces. Ice cream, popsicles, and other frozen treats lend themselves well to kawaii interpretations, with dripping details and cheerful expressions. Candies, chocolates, and cookies are transformed into miniature works of art, complete with rosy cheeks and charming smiles. Even fruit-themed desserts, such as strawberry shortcake and fruit parfaits, can be given a kawaii makeover, adding a touch of whimsy to healthy treats.

While the core principles of kawaii art remain consistent, artists often experiment with different styles and mediums. Chibi style, characterized by small, cartoonish figures with large heads and simplified bodies, is a popular choice for creating cute and expressive dessert drawings. Watercolor illustrations offer a softer, more delicate approach, allowing artists to capture the subtle nuances of color and texture. Digital art, with its clean lines and vibrant hues, provides a versatile platform for creating detailed and visually striking kawaii dessert drawings. And marker drawings, with their bold lines and expressive strokes, offer a more dynamic and spontaneous approach to this delightful art form.

The Rise of Kawaii Dessert Food Drawings

The internet has played a pivotal role in the rising popularity of kawaii dessert food drawings. Social media platforms like Instagram, Pinterest, and Tumblr have become havens for artists to share their work, connect with fellow enthusiasts, and gain inspiration. The hashtag #kawaiidessert alone yields thousands upon thousands of charming images. These online communities provide a supportive environment for artists to showcase their talents, receive feedback, and build a following. Popular artists in this niche often amass significant online audiences, inspiring countless others to explore their own creativity. The ease of sharing and discovering artwork has transformed the art world, making kawaii dessert food drawings accessible to a global audience.

The appeal of kawaii dessert food drawings extends beyond the realm of art, finding its way into various commercial applications. You’ll find these adorable illustrations adorning everything from stickers and phone cases to stationery and clothing. Food companies often use kawaii art on their packaging and branding to attract consumers, especially younger audiences. And, of course, kawaii dessert drawings are frequently featured in children’s books and educational materials, making learning fun and engaging.

Embarking on Your Kawaii Dessert Drawing Journey

Inspired to create your own dessert kawaii cute food drawings? Getting started is easier than you might think. Numerous step-by-step tutorials are available online, catering to artists of all skill levels. These tutorials break down the process into manageable steps, guiding you through the basics of drawing simple shapes, adding expressive features, and applying color. YouTube channels and websites dedicated to kawaii art offer a wealth of resources, from drawing demonstrations to coloring techniques.

The right art supplies can also make a difference. Start with the basics: pencils, erasers, and a sketchbook. As you progress, you can explore different coloring materials, such as markers, colored pencils, and watercolors. For those interested in digital art, software programs like Adobe Photoshop and Procreate, along with a graphics tablet, provide a powerful toolset for creating stunning kawaii illustrations.
